Android: Treat ACTION_CANCEL as TouchCancelEvent
Change 64d62c53c1e92a1cc07449a0ea3c71501592c1e7 started treating an ACTION_CANCEL as a TouchPointReleased. This leads to unintentional presses, if e.g. an edge swipe for the android back gesture starts on a MouseArea. When Android takes possession of the motion, an ACTION_CANCEL is delivered, which needs to be handled as such. It should not be treated as a normal up event that triggers a press. Otherwise, we get the above-mentioned issue, where an unintentional action is performed. So let's use QWindowSystemInterface::handleTouchCancelEvent to treat it as a canceled touch in Qt.
